    just like i said ---- 20 posts ago. I speak bikeineese and carineese!


    Normal shifting on a bike is 1 down and 5 up.
    GPR shifting is 1 up and 5 down. IT makes sure that comming out of a hard corner you are pushing down on your bike not pulling up on it. Gives the rides better balance etc.


    now.. as for why you would do it for stunting.. i have no idea. Stunters do cages, naked bikes, 55+ tooth rear sprockets and sometimes they do some brake modification so rear up on the grip
